Peaks Mt. Liberty, Mt. Flume, NH
Trails
Trails: Bike path, herd path, Liberty Spring Trail, Franconia Ridge Trail
Date of Hike
Date of Hike: Wednesday, December 29, 2021
Parking/Access Road Notes
Parking/Access Road Notes: Plenty of parking at The Basin. 
Surface Conditions
Surface Conditions: Snow - Packed Powder/Loose Granular, Snow/Ice - Frozen Granular 
Recommended Equipment
Recommended Equipment: Snowshoes, Light Traction 
Water Crossing Notes
Water Crossing Notes: Water was low and easy to rock hop or use the minor ice bridges. 
Trail Maintenance Notes
Trail Maintenance Notes: Trails in good shape and clear of most blowdowns.  
Dog-Related Notes
Dog-Related Notes: Fine hike for a seasoned trail pup. 
Bugs
Bugs:  
Lost and Found
Lost and Found:  
 
Comments
Comments: I used light traction all day and carried my snowshoes. In hind sight, snowshoes would have been slightly more efficient from Liberty Spring Tentsite to Mt Flume and back. There is a bypass around the rocky summit of Liberty although the awkward ledge just south of the summit was nicely filled in. There were a some tracks heading south from Mt Flume as well as north of Liberty Spring Tr where it looked like a snowshoes would be useful. Nice to cross paths again with Hiker Ed.
